### Understanding Why Root Canal Therapy Is Needed

A root canal is typically required when the innermost layer of the tooth — called the pulp — becomes infected or inflamed. This can happen due to deep decay, cracked fillings, or injuries that expose the roots. Without proper treatment, bacteria multiply inside the tooth, leading to severe pain, swelling, or even abscess formation. Many people try to ignore the discomfort or rely on painkillers, but that only masks the problem temporarily. A root canal actually addresses the root cause (literally) by cleaning out the infection and protecting your tooth from future damage.

### How Root Canal Therapy Works in Thailand

In Thailand, dental clinics follow international standards of sterilization and clinical care. The procedure itself is straightforward and usually completed in one to two visits, depending on the tooth condition.

1. **Diagnosis and X-ray** – Your Thai dentist will start with a detailed examination and take an X-ray to see how deep the infection has gone.

2. **Local Anesthesia** – The area is numbed so you won’t feel pain during treatment. Most Thai dentists are known for their gentle touch and clear communication, helping you stay comfortable throughout.

3. **Cleaning and Shaping** – The infected pulp is removed, and the inside of the tooth is cleaned and shaped properly to prevent further bacterial growth.

4. **Filling the Canal** – The cleaned canal is then filled with a special biocompatible material, sealing it tightly.

5. **Crown Placement (if needed)** – To restore strength and appearance, a dental crown may be placed on top of the treated tooth. Thai dental labs now offer natural-looking crowns that match your smile perfectly.

With local expertise and advanced equipment such as digital imaging and rotary endodontic systems, the entire process is precise, efficient, and safe.

### Aftercare and Recovery Tips

After a root canal therapy session, mild sensitivity or tenderness is normal for a short period. Your Thai dentist will give instructions to help you recover smoothly. Common recommendations include:

- Avoid chewing hard foods on the treated tooth until your permanent crown is fitted.

- Brush gently and use a soft toothbrush.

- Rinse with warm salt water to reduce swelling.

- Attend follow-up appointments as advised.

Most patients report feeling immediate relief compared to the pain they had before treatment. Proper post-care ensures your restored tooth lasts for many years.

### Why Delaying Treatment Can Be Risky

Many people hesitate to get a root canal because of fear or misconceptions. However, postponing treatment can make the infection spread to surrounding tissues, leading to more severe complications and even tooth loss. In some cases, untreated infections can affect neighboring teeth or the jawbone. In Thailand, dental clinics emphasize early intervention — not just to save the tooth, but to maintain your overall health and prevent unnecessary stress later.
